Output 581f9aae39658790f6a44cd026dfc8e1a5e57fd06942363865361f93b17bde4d:0

value
594619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fdd7e0a3d4f02c7042413c2eefee66d3aafee64 OP_EQUAL
address
3DM75TsLpbPZAreq9oZB5iGhhrikVVbEGJ
transaction
581f9aae39658790f6a44cd026dfc8e1a5e57fd06942363865361f93b17bde4d
spent
true